| Year | Winner | Party | Votes | Vote share | Runner-up | Margin |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1967 | P. SIVASANKARAN | DMK | 2,71,528 | 60.61% | K. SAMBANDAN | 1,01,765 |
| 1962 | P. SIVASANKARAN | DMK | 1,57,733 | 52.56% | K. MUNUSWAMY | 15,372 |
